Output 15f3833063ada9d3d357697a623219aa3df622abbfe029aee2afae1514f21f8d:5

value
21005098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7199cd422f99181db46619786153c874059fa10a OP_EQUAL
address
MJFpqSdu7KFgjWMvh2nakUwpythp7gRk9S
transaction
15f3833063ada9d3d357697a623219aa3df622abbfe029aee2afae1514f21f8d
spent
true